Description
This is an older glass bottle in compressed form, with recessed oval foot and a flat lip. The cap is agate. The blue overlay glass is thick and the design of six horses is rather unusual. One panel shows two confronting horses in prancing position, each with one leg up and three legs standing. This type of pose is often associated with the pottery horses of the Tang Dynasty CE 618 to 907. The rulers of the Tang Dynasty had nomadic origins and horses were an important part of their daily living. They rode, played polo, fought, hunt, all on horseback. During the high Tang period, horses were trained to perform dances and do dressage. On the other side are four horses all engaged in action - striding, jumping and prancing. The decorative elements are quite unusual and well done. Date: post 1950's Dimensions: 6 cm wide, 8 cm high Weight: 2.5 ounces - 70.8 gm.
